Maplewood Farm in North Vancouver is a must-see attraction for kids of all ages. Maplewood is the last remaining farm on the North Shore, with goats, rabbits, cows, sheep, pigs, chickens, ducks, donkeys and ponies. There are over 200 animals and birds. There is a covered picnic shelter where you can eat your lunch.
You can get up close with the goats in the petting areas. You can feed the ducks and the rabbits, so don’t forget to bring some bunny food along. Duck food can be purchased with your entrance tickets.
There is a small gift shop located in the main entrance area with all kinds of farm related merchandise. You can also rent little ride on tractors which are quite fun.
